Baltimore’s Haunted History

Originally developed as a seaport city, Baltimore is teeming with history. 

Because of its harbor and proximity to other major east coast ports, Baltimore was on the front lines of almost every major war in the nation’s early days, from the Revolutionary War to the Civil War. You’ll find much of that history preserved in the many world-class museums that line Baltimore’s streets.  

For decades in the late 19th and early 20th century, Baltimore was one of the biggest immigration hubs in the nation, second only to Ellis Island. Today, that past is anything but a distant memory. It is evident in the dozens of communities and neighborhoods that still adamantly retain their cultural integrity, such as Baltimore’s famous Little Italy. 

You’ll even see Baltimore’s famed streets on the silver screen due to the city’s artistic and cinematic presence. The renowned Maryland Film Festival gets hosted here every year and brings massive attention from the film industry.
